About the Role

Description

This position is for Mid-County Outpatient Center in Port Arthur, Texas.
Summary:
The Occupational Therapist has the responsibility and accountability for assessing, planning, evaluating and implementing care for the patients ordered occupational therapy. The Occupational Therapist is responsible for adhering to all standards of Occupational Therapy Practice Act as they apply to providing technical therapy care, supplies, equipment and interventions to a designated patient population.

Responsibilities:

• Responsible for the utilization and supervision of volunteers, students, support staff, and assistants relating to the provision of occupational therapy services 

• Responsible for interpretation/implementation of physician orders, provision of safe care to customers, protection of confidential information, professional communication, economic use of time/resources, and creation of a positive work/therapy environment 

• Performs other diverse duties as requested 

Requirements:

Education/Skills 

• Master's Degree 

Licenses, Registrations, or Certifications 

• OT License in the state of employment 

• BLS 

Work Schedule:

8AM - 5PM
2-3 shifts a week
Monday - Friday
No holidays or weekends

Work Type:

Part time
